WebMay 28, 2012 · Sorted by: 76. In Visual Studio go to: Tools Options Environment Keyboard. Find "Edit.DeleteBackwards" command. In "Use new shortcut in:" dropdown select "Text Editor". In "Press shortcut keys:" click backspace so it would show "Bkspce". Click "OK". Backspace should start working for you again. WebAug 23, 2024 · Debugging MSTest in Visual Studio 2024.3 (15.3): 'Inconclusive: Test not run' Ctrl+Click navigation looks broken in VS2024; ReSharper 2016.3 does not discover … WebI have observed that the undo option is being disabled when I press CTRL + ENTER accidentally, and I fixed this by removing this hotkey. To do this go to : Tools -> Option -> Environment -> Keyboard and remove Edit.LineOpenAbove shortcut. Share Improve this answer Follow edited Dec 7, 2012 at 9:02 Jude Fisher 11.1k 7 48 91
